scci at activities The Kil Kare Klub and Trojan club have held Joint meetings on three occasions this year The first such meeting consisted of a watermelon feed furnished by the Trojans The second Joint meeting was sponsored-by the Freshman Trojan Club boys. Entertainment was furnished by a Charlie Chaplin movie The third meeting, prepared by the Kil Kare Klub girls, was held March 8. All girls in high school participated. Officer: Kil Kare Klub—Pres Mary Koster, Vice-Pres. Alyce Con- don, Sec. Lila Townsend, Treas. Rea Belle Wheeler. Trojan Club-—Pres. Melvin Stout, Vice-Pres. Merle McDougall, Sec.-Treas. Luverne Meyerhoff. The banquet schedule of the year was begun by the Kil Kare Klub Mother-daughter banquet held November 1. Members of the Trojan Club served the banqueteers, seated at tables decorated in bright autumn— colors. Miss Catherine Peck, social director at the Iowa State Teachers College, gave an interesting talk on Personal Development in which she used William, a hippopotomus, as an important, character. Robert Bucknr.ster was the speaker at the annual Trojan Club Father-son banquet held November 14 in the dining room. The Sophomore cooking class under Miss King s guidance served the guests who were seated at tables decorated by the Wild Life theme. The Dunkerton Student Council were hosts to the Student Council delegates from Orange, Jesup, Hudson, and Geneseo on February 7. The three holidays in February were commemorated. Views were exchanged and discussed pertaining to various school problems. The Faculty Club meets every Tuesday night for a business meeting after which they have speakers on various subjects. The social side of the faculty Club comes every month when the members meet with various hosts and hostesses to play bridge or bingo. The women faculty members hold a potluck supper once every two weeks after which they do everything from cross-word puzzles to knitting. The PTA banquet was held April 16 in the dining room. Maypoles was the theme for the decorations. Mr. Lambertson of Cedar Falls spoke. The Climax of the year came when the Juniors and Seniors gathered in Black s Tearoom on Hay 7, for the annual Junior-Senior banquet. The theme All Aboard was carried out in table decorations and speeches.

DIIUMKS The aim of the Dramatics Club this year has been individual talent development in the dramatic field. Our second aim: bow finished a play we could present. All who tried out for one-acts were given a part. The play Dust of the Road by Kenneth Sawyer Goodman, was given at the Christmas program. Taking part were; Irene Smith, Gordon Miller, LaVeme Herman, and Melvin Stout. Play Festivals involving Hudson, Orange, Jesup, and Dunkerton schools were held during the year. White Phantom by Wilbur Braun, was presented at Orange. In the cast were; Juva Turner, Marlys Speer, Merle McDougall, Harold Baer, Alyce Condon, Rea Belle Wheeler, and LaVeme Herman. At Hudson, our club gave Winter Sunset by Robert Brome. Melvii Stout, Merle McDougall, Leora Bellmer, and Ilene Smith took part. Joint Owners in Spain by Alice Brown, was given at Jesup. This play consisted of an all girl cast which included Betty Schmidt, Juva Turner, Irene Smith, and Lila Townsend. Yellow Tickets also by Robert Brome, was cast as a sophomore project with Rea Belle Wheeler acting as assistant director to Miss Ashley. This also contained an all girl cast of: Leona Stout, Lois Hofftnan, Miriam Hein, Jean Whipple, Laura Westlic, Frances Smith, and Donna Westlic. On February 23, four of our one-acts were presented here. They were, Winter Sunset , White Phantom , Yellow Tickets , and Joint Owners in Spain. 21
